vulkaninfo: fix memory leaks from pNext chains
Change-Id: I99965dabaf7307e52c56f779d79f259fc379c7da
diff --git a/vulkaninfo/vulkaninfo.c b/vulkaninfo/vulkaninfo.c
index c499937..5103e79 100644
--- a/vulkaninfo/vulkaninfo.c
+++ b/vulkaninfo/vulkaninfo.c
@@ -1281,6 +1281,7 @@
free(gpu->queue_props2);
freepNextChain(gpu->props2.pNext);
+ freepNextChain(gpu->memory_props2.pNext);
}
}
@@ -2130,6 +2131,7 @@
}
place = work->pNext;
}
+ freepNextChain(surface_capabilities2.pNext);
}
if (html_output) {
fprintf(out, "\t\t\t\t\t</details>\n");